Transaction 351499086dc96a3ef1799860f15185dd241776f85429a36eac630faeb1108fdc
1 Input
1 Output
-
351499086dc96a3ef1799860f15185dd241776f85429a36eac630faeb1108fdc:0
- value
- 3088942
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03a0317aa788ccb2d9614c8a5718c0f5d27c2d3c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LAvzyXhWFB9Y7HVBoNpBhrrETZTm7kxs